Jane Norton

Brief Life History of Jane

When Jane Norton was born about 1810, in Ontario, Canada, her father, Eleazer Norton, was 22 and her mother, Anna Brock, was 22. She married George Shier on 26 December 1836, in Brock, Durham, Ontario, Canada. They were the parents of at least 6 sons and 2 daughters. She died in 1878, at the age of 69.

Name Meaning

English: habitational name from any of the many places so called, from Old English north ‘north’ + tūn ‘enclosure, settlement’. In some cases it is a variant of Norrington .

Irish: altered form of Naughton , assimilated to the English name (see 1 above).

Jewish (American): adoption of the English surname (see 1 above) in place of some similar (like-sounding) original Ashkenazic surname.

Dictionary of American Family Names © Patrick Hanks 2003, 2006.
